I can’t remember when I did my last Stitch Fix review but several of you asked about my pink cardigan I shared on Friday. It came from my latest fix and so I thought I’d share what I received in my June box.

I also know some of  you aren’t interested in using the service but sometimes it’s nice to see what they send and if you’re out shopping you might find something similar at TJ Maxx or Marshall’s. I do this all the time with other bloggers.

So here’s what I received in my box:

41Hawthorn Bryan Short-Sleeve Open-Front Cardigan-The 41Hawthorn brand is one of my favorites from Stitch fix and I believe it’s exclusive to them. You can’t find this brand in the stores. I loved the color so this one was a keeper!

Liverpool Ankle Length colored Skinny Jean-I’ve worked with this company before and I love their jeans. Again, I loved the color and these were a keeper!

Tart Juliano Chevron Twist Shoulder Cowl Neck Top-I loved the material, it was soft and it wouldn’t wrinkle but t was too big and did nothing for me so this one got sent back.

Renee C Cheli Striped Maxi Dress-I wanted to like this one! But when I tried it on, I wasn’t crazy about it. I think if it were longer, I might have kept it but this one went back.

Papermoon Corbin Tie-Waist Chebron Print Hi-Lo Top-I love this one! I love the bright color and I love that it is a hi-lo top. This one I kept!

Overall, I liked what they sent me. I don’t expect all of it to work but if I get a couple of cute pieces, I’m happy.
